The broth, the soul of the soup, is crafted from a blend of chicken bones, carrots, celery, and onions. These ingredients simmer together for hours, extracting their vitamins and minerals into the water. The resulting broth is rich, aromatic, and brimming with healing properties. Carrots, known for their beta-carotene content, offer a boost to our immune system, while celery and onions add a depth of flavor that can't be replicated by any artificial substitute.
To enhance the flavor and medicinal properties of the soup, we've added a selection of herbs and spices. Garlic, with its potent anti-inflammatory and immune-boosting properties, is a staple in this recipe. Ginger, another powerful root, not only adds a zing to the broth but also supports digestion and reduces inflammation. Turmeric, with its vibrant yellow hue, is a treasure trove of curcumin, a compound that has been shown to have anti-cancer and anti-inflammatory effects.
For a touch of sweetness and depth, we've included diced tomatoes and a splash of apple cider vinegar. The tomatoes contribute lycopene, an antioxidant that protects our cells from damage, while the vinegar helps to break down the nutrients in the other ingredients, making them more accessible to our bodies.
To make this soup truly a potluck of nature's bounty, we've added a variety of vegetables. Sliced carrots, diced potatoes, and shredded kale provide a colorful medley of nutrients, including fiber, vitamins, and minerals. The potatoes, in particular, are a great source of potassium, which helps to maintain normal blood pressure and heart function.
No healing potluck is complete without a few added bonuses. To boost the immune system, we've included a generous handful of spinach and a sprinkle of dried seaweed. Spinach is loaded with iron, folate, and vitamins A, C, and K, while seaweed offers a wealth of minerals, including iodine, which is essential for thyroid function.
Finally, to round out this culinary creation, we've added a touch of umami, the fifth taste, with a sprinkle of miso paste. Miso is a fermented soybean product that has been used for centuries in Japanese cuisine. It's rich in probiotics, which promote gut health, and provides a delightful depth of flavor that complements the other ingredients.
